Summary:
"This book investigates how the active economy incorporates all enterprises participating in, or contributing to, improving individual or community prosperity through the development and delivery of active living, sport, active recreation, physical education, physical literacy, indoor and outdoor play, health, wellness, and all other associated sectors"-- Provided by publisher.
